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l Ingredients
For the Salmon
• Salmon Fillets – A rich source of omega-3 fatty acids; choose wild-caught for superior flavor.
• Soy Sauce – Adds umami depth to the marinade; tamari works for a gluten-free option.
• Sriracha Sauce – Provides that signature heat; modify the amount for a milder or spicier kick.
• Honey – A delightful natural sweetener that balances the spice of sriracha; substitute with maple syrup for a vegan twist.
• Minced Garlic – Elevates the flavor profile; fresh is best, but jarred can save time.
• Lime Juice – Brightens the dish with acidity; lemon juice can be used if you prefer.
• Olive Oil – Essential for cooking; use high-heat oils like avocado oil as an alternative.
For the Toppings
• Vegetables (Avocado, Cucumber, Shredded Carrot, Edamame, Cilantro) – Fresh additions that enhance texture and flavor; mix and match your favorites.
• Spicy Mayo – For an extra kick; easily make your own by mixing mayonnaise with sriracha.
• Sesame Seeds – An optional garnish that adds crunch and visual appeal.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l
Step 1: Prepare Marinade
In a bowl, whisk together sriracha sauce, honey, soy sauce, minced garlic, and lime juice until fully blended. Aim for a glossy consistency that combines sweet and spicy aromas. This flavorful marinade will infuse the salmon with zest. Set it aside while you prepare the salmon, ensuring the ingredients are well mixed for the perfect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l.
Step 2: Marinate Salmon
Place the salmon fillets in a shallow dish or resealable bag, then pour the marinade over them, ensuring each piece is thoroughly coated. Seal the bag or cover the dish, then ref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to penetrate. This resting time will yield moist, flavorful salmon once cooked, so don’t skip this step to achieve the best taste.
Step 3: Cook Salmon
Preheat a non-stick frying pan over medium-high heat, adding a drizzle of olive oil to prevent sticking. Once the oil shimmers, carefully place the salmon skin-side down in the hot pan. Cook for about 2-3 minutes, or until the skin is crispy and easily flakes with a fork. This stage is crucial for creating a delightful texture in your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l.
Step 4: Flip and Finish Cooking
Gently flip the salmon using a spatula and continue cooking for an additional 2-3 minutes, taking care not to overcook. The salmon should be slightly pink in the center—this ensures it’s flaky and tender. The exterior should have a beautiful caramelization from the cooking process, which will add depth to your bowl’s flavor profile.
Step 5: Assemble Bowl
While the salmon rests, prepare your bowl by starting with a base of rice or quinoa for added nutrition. Layer on freshly sliced avocado, cucumber, shredded carrots, and edamame to bring a colorful crunch. Once the salmon has rested, place it atop the vibrant veggies, creating a feast for the eyes that makes the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l truly enticing.
Step 6: Add Finishing Touches
To elevate your bowl, drizzle spicy mayo over the top for an extra kick. Sprinkle with fresh cilantro and sesame seeds for that final burst of flavor and crunch. These finishing touches will not only enhance the taste but also create an appealing presentation that’s sure to impress family and friends at dinner.

How to Store and Freeze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l
Fridge: Store leftover salmon and vegetables in airtight containers for up to 2 days. Keeping them separate ensures the salmon stays moist and prevents veggies from becoming soggy.
Freezer: The marinated salmon can be frozen for up to 3 months before cooking. Wrap each fillet tightly in plastic wrap followed by foil for optimal freshness.
Reheating: To reheat, thaw in the fridge overnight, then warm up on a skillet over medium heat until heated through. Avoid microwaving, as it can dry out the salmon.
Prep Ahead: If you have excess marinade, store it separately in the fridge for up to 1 week. This can be used to marinate fresh salmon or other proteins for your next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l!

Expert Tips for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l
-
Marinade Timing: Allow the salmon to marinate for at least 30 minutes; this ensures robust flavor penetration and prevents dryness when cooked.
-
Cooking Heat: Ensure your pan is preheated adequately before adding the salmon; a hot pan helps achieve that irresistible crispy skin, essential for the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l.
-
Checking Doneness: Look for salmon that flakes easily with a fork, maintaining a slight pinkness in the center; this keeps the fish moist while preventing overcooking.
-
Colorful Customization: Feel free to include a variety of vegetables according to your preferences; not only does this enhance taste and nutrition, but it also adds vibrancy to your bowl.
-
Storage Wisdom: When saving leftovers, keep the salmon and toppings in separate airtight containers; this ensures freshness and prevents sogginess, allowing you to enjoy your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l later!
Make Ahead Options
Preparing the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l in advance is a brilliant way to save time on busy weeknights! You can marinate the salmon up to 24 hours ahead by combining the marinade ingredients and letting the fillets soak in the refrigerator—this not only infuses flavor but also ensures a tender result. Additionally, chop your vegetables (like avocado, cucumber, and carrots) and store them in airtight containers for up to 3 days; this keeps them fresh and crisp. When you’re ready to enjoy your bowl, simply cook the marinated salmon as directed, assemble your prepped toppings, and drizzle with spicy mayo for a quick, delicious meal that feels gourmet with minimal effort!
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l Variations
Feel free to get creative with the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l, enhancing your culinary experience with these delicious twists!
-
Vegetarian Swap: Use marinated tofu or tempeh instead of salmon for a satisfying plant-based version. The marinade infuses these ingredients with the same sweet and spicy notes.
-
Gluten-Free Option: Substitute soy sauce with tamari to create a gluten-free marinade without losing any of that delicious umami flavor. This option ensures everyone can enjoy the dish!
-
Flavor Boost: Add a drizzle of sesame oil before serving for a nutty depth that pairs perfectly with the sweet-spicy flavors of the bowl. This simple addition can make all the difference!
-
Extra Crunch: Experiment with crushed peanuts or cashews as a topping for a delightful texture contrast. This brings a satisfying crunch that enhances your bowl’s overall experience.
-
Spice It Up: For those who love heat, mix in a few slices of fresh jalapeño or a splash of chili oil to your marinade for an extra fiery kick. Turn the flavor dial up, and let those taste buds rejoice!
-
Citrus Zing: Swap lime juice for fresh orange juice in the marinade for a bright, fruity twist. It adds a refreshing element that beautifully balances the dish’s spice.
-
Veggie Variety: Try tossing in roasted sweet potatoes or steamed broccoli for a heartier meal that still maintains balance. Mixing in these vegetables can enhance flavor and boost nutrition.
-
Rice Alternatives: Ditch the traditional base and use cauliflower rice or a mixed grain blend for a lighter, lower-carb option, pairing beautifully with the savory salmon.

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l Recipe FAQs
How do I choose ripe ingredients for my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l?
Absolutely! For the best flavor and texture, select ripe avocados that yield slightly to pressure and look vibrant in color. When picking cucumbers, choose firm ones without dark spots or wrinkles. The carrots should be crisp and bright, while the edamame should be bright green with none of the pods being discolored or mushy.
What is the best way to store leftovers of the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l?
Very! Store leftover salmon and toppings separately in airtight containers. This method preserves the salmon’s moisture and prevents the vegetables from becoming soggy. Consume within 2 days for optimal freshness and taste. You can also layer parchment paper between the components to keep them fresh longer!
Can I freeze the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l?
Absolutely! You can freeze the marinated salmon for up to 3 months. Wrap each fillet tightly in plastic wrap, followed by a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n. To thaw, place the wrapped salmon in the refrigerator overnight before cooking. Avoid freezing the vegetables as they may lose their crunch and freshness.
What if my salmon is overcooked?
It’s a common challenge! If you accidentally overcook your salmon, which may leave it dry, try serving it with a drizzle of extra spicy mayo or a squeeze of fresh lime juice to add moisture and enhance flavors. You can also shred the salmon and mix it with a little olive oil and some spices to bring it back to life as a flavorful topping for a salad or wrap.
Are there any dietary considerations for the Honey Sriracha Salmon Bowl?
Indeed! If you’re preparing this dish for someone with allergies, be cautious of soy sauce, which contains gluten. Opt for tamari as a gluten-free alternative. Also, consider that sriracha usually contains garlic; if allergies are present, you can substitute it with a milder chili sauce. For vegan options, simply replace the salmon with tofu or tempeh to enjoy the same delicious flavors!
